Langley Sportsplex
Langley Sportsplex is a major indoor recreation complex housing four ice hockey rinks — described on its own website as the only facility of its kind in Canada — along with a fitness centre, sports equipment retail, health clinics, daycare, and the Offside Cafe. Located roughly 30 minutes from downtown Vancouver, it draws over half a million visitors annually and hosts leagues, tournaments, public skating, training programs, and summer day camps. Touring cyclists in the Fraser Valley would find a sizable hub with on-site food and multiple services, though the facility has no evident cycling focus.
